Output ffab537da985ccea46ba36aae12860488f732b529f6546dd7f3dc5e881eca71b:0

value
23316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4da86820070a478c2723af2def7302a32e66259a OP_EQUAL
address
38mdhRKFZvCKqxerLbPzsRbpBWmsfRZPQG
transaction
ffab537da985ccea46ba36aae12860488f732b529f6546dd7f3dc5e881eca71b
spent
true